About Bankruptcy Law in Davao City, Philippines

Bankruptcy law in Davao City, Philippines, refers to the legal process by which individuals or businesses who are unable to repay their debts can seek relief from their financial obligations. In Davao City, bankruptcy is governed by the provisions of the Financial Rehabilitation and Insolvency Act of 2010, which provides a framework for individuals and corporations to reorganize their debts and assets to repay creditors or have their debts discharged.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

There are several situations where individuals may require legal assistance in bankruptcy, including:

  • Understanding the bankruptcy process and deciding which type of bankruptcy is right for them
  • Filing for bankruptcy and submitting the necessary documents to the court
  • Negotiating with creditors to restructure debts or develop a repayment plan
  • Defending against creditor actions or challenges to the bankruptcy filing
